Transaction 521baf7941b6fd500efa4b00a49050423a4850f47ee424c64ec15e7c364b7964

2 Input
2 Outputs
  • 521baf7941b6fd500efa4b00a49050423a4850f47ee424c64ec15e7c364b7964:0
  • value  20884000
    address  36EbUFXyxh2Kitjt4976cvYyt5jCtpTWN3
  • 521baf7941b6fd500efa4b00a49050423a4850f47ee424c64ec15e7c364b7964:1
  • value  38845115
    address  14XkQFPiCVjVuuBeVfK6u9o7x8Ayv7DhRE